0729 160306 16500 viewsRobe River ore waggon 729, built by Tomlinson Steel WA, fixed coupler non-handbrake side loaded view, at the 45 km, Harding Siding on the Cape Lambert line. March 6, 2016.

139-04371 viewsBallarat station yard, V/Line broad gauge VHEF type bogie briquette hopper waggon VHEF 729, side view. Originally built new in 1982 by V/Line Workshops in a batch of thirty five as type VHEY, recoded to VHEF in 1987/88.

140601 4665216 viewsMidland, loaded iron ore train #1030 heading to Kwinana, CFCLA leased CHCH type waggon CHCH 7729 these waggons were rebuilt between 2010 and 2012 by Bluebird Rail Operations SA from former Goldsworthy Mining hopper waggons originally built by Tomlinson WA and Scotts of Ipswich Qld back in the 60's to early 80's. 1st June 2014.

160525 4550314 viewsParkeston, SCT train 3PG1 which operates from Perth to Parkes NSW (Goobang Junction) arrives round the curve behind SCT class SCT 005 serial 07-1729 is an EDI Downer built EMD model GT46C-ACe and sister loco SCT 011 with 73 waggons for 3381 tonnes and 1726 metres.
